What they do
A Medical Assistant assists physicians and other medical specialists with routine administrative or clinical tasks. Organizes patient records, schedules appointments, and prepares medical equipment. May specialize in administrative or clinical work, or specialize in a particular area of medicine, i.e. assisting in the office of an ophthalmologist (eye specialist). Works in medical offices.

Job Description
Position Description:
Medical assistant will perform various administrative and clinical tasks. Administrative responsibilities include greeting patients as they arrive, answering telephones, scheduling appointments, and updating and filing patients' medical records. Clinical responsibilities include taking medical histories and recording vital signs, explaining treatment procedures to patients, preparing patients for examination, and assisting the physician during examinations.Duties and Responsibilities:
